Won't update catalogues on cd-rw or dvd-rw 
V3.25 fails to update catalogues on cd or dvd, it only checks floppy drive. to update a cd or dvd, must delete old catatalogue, and start a new catalogue for the updated cd or dvd. won't work on a home network, with multi users trying to access the catalogues. no simple one button formatted printed output, only plain text, does have many options to output to database which is good, but i would like one button simple printed output to a4 portrait.

Response by software author 
Version 4 has 6 new reports windows style. Re-cataloguing function has been improved. It has no network functions, as is designed for standalone users (limited network read-only multiuser mode it is supposed to work, but no support about this).
